Low-temperature nitrogen plasma ion treatment for powder metallurgy molds and cutting tools.
Low-temperature nitrogen plasma ion treatment
Increase the hardness of cemented carbide at low temperatures to extend the lifespan of molds and tools.
It is possible to increase the hardness and lifespan of molds and tools made of ultra-hard alloys by using nitrogen ions. Since this is not a coating, it does not change the shape of the product. Additionally, because no heaters are used, there is no deformation due to heat. Please feel free to contact us when facing severe usage conditions that cannot be resolved by various coatings. We have a proven track record in applications such as addressing wear on the inner surfaces of powder metallurgy molds under high pressure, or situations where there is a desire not to change the cutting edge shape of cutting tools used for processing high-hardness materials.

【Features】 ■ The hardness and wear resistance of cemented carbide are improved by nitrogen ion implantation. ■ Surface modification can be performed according to the heat resistance temperature of the equipment. ■ Low-temperature treatment prevents distortion of the base material. ■ Machining is possible on the inner surface of molds.
